<p><a href="https://winsides.com/how-to-disable-copilot-in-windows-11/" data-type="post" data-id="225">Windows Copilot</a> is a useful assistant built into <a href="https://winsides.com/" data-type="link" data-id="https://winsides.com/">Windows 11</a>, providing quick access to features and tools to boost productivity. It sits on the taskbar, ready to help with tasks like <strong>web searches</strong>, <strong>settings management</strong>, and <strong>reminders</strong>. However, for me, having the Copilot icon constantly <strong>visible on the taskbar</strong> can be distracting, especially true for those who have recently <strong>upgraded from Windows 10 to Windows 11</strong>.</p>



<p>If you find that the <a href="https://copilot.microsoft.com/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">Copilot</a> icon on the taskbar is causing disturbances, there is a simple solution. You can remove the Copilot icon from the <strong>taskbar without disabling</strong> the feature entirely. This way, you can maintain a <strong>cleaner, organized taskbar</strong> while still having Copilot available for when you need it. Follow these steps to achieve a more streamlined taskbar without losing access to Copilot&#8217;s functionalities.</p>



<blockquote class="wp-block-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ow">
<h2 class="wp-block-heading">Key Steps:</h2>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li><strong>Right-click on the Taskbar</strong>: Select &#8220;Taskbar settings.&#8221;</li>



<li><strong>Customize Taskbar</strong>: Scroll to find &#8220;Taskbar items.&#8221;</li>



<li><strong>Turn Off Copilot</strong>: Toggle off the switch for Copilot.</li>
</ul>
</blockquote>

<h2 class="wp-block-heading">Steps to Remove Copilot:</h2>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Right click on the Taskbar</strong>:</h3>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>You need to <strong>right click</strong> on an empty space on your <strong>taskbar</strong>.</li>



<li>A <strong>context menu</strong> will appear with multiple options related to <strong>taskbar settings and customization</strong>.</li>
</ul>



<figure class="wp-block-image aligncenter size-full"><img decoding="async" width="676" height="226"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/IL7YeLo2ve.webp" alt="Right click on the Taskbar" class="wp-image-1134" title="Right click on the Taskbar"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/IL7YeLo2ve.webp 676w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/IL7YeLo2ve-300x100.webp 300w" sizes="(max-width: 676px) 100vw, 676px" /><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">Right click on the Taskbar</figcaption></figure>



<p><strong>Select &gt; Taskbar settings</strong>:</p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>Now, From the context menu, you need to click on &#8220;<strong>Taskbar settings.</strong>&#8220;</li>



<li>This will open the <strong>Settings app</strong> directly to the <strong>Taskbar settings page</strong>.</li>
</ul>



<figure class="wp-block-image aligncenter size-full is-resized"><img decoding="async" width="1920" height="1080"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/Open-Task-Bar-Settings.webp" alt="Taskbar Settings Page" class="wp-image-1135" style="width:736px;height:auto" title="Taskbar Settings Page"/><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">Taskbar Settings Page</figcaption></figure>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Open &gt; Taskbar items</strong>:</h3>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>In the Taskbar settings, <strong>scroll down</strong> or most probably you can find the &#8220;<strong>Taskbar items</strong>&#8221; section in the <strong>beginning itself</strong>.</li>



<li>This section allows you to modify which <strong>icons and its functionalities</strong> are <strong>visible on your taskbar</strong>.</li>
</ul>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" width="1024" height="273"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_42SPNAVOop-1024x273.webp" alt="Accessing Taskbar Items" class="wp-image-1136" title="Accessing Taskbar Items"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_42SPNAVOop-1024x273.webp 1024w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_42SPNAVOop-300x80.webp 300w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_42SPNAVOop-768x205.webp 768w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_42SPNAVOop-1536x410.webp 1536w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_42SPNAVOop.webp 1824w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px" /><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">Accessing Taskbar Items</figcaption></figure>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Toggle off the switch for Copilot</strong>:</h3>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>Now you need to look for the switch labeled &#8220;<strong>Copilot.</strong>&#8220;</li>



<li>Toggle this switch <strong>off</strong> to <strong>remove the Copilot icon</strong> from your taskbar.</li>



<li>This action <strong>only removes the Copilot icon from the taskbar</strong> without <strong><a href="https://winsides.com/how-to-disable-copilot-in-windows-11/" data-type="post" data-id="225">disabling</a></strong> the feature completely or <a href="https://winsides.com/disable-microsoft-copilot-in-edge-browser/" data-type="post" data-id="242">disabling it from edge browser</a> and it allowing you to <strong>enable it again</strong> if needed.</li>
</ul>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" width="1024" height="265"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_vzakTnWozp-1024x265.webp" alt="Remove Copilot Preview from Windows" class="wp-image-1137" title="Remove Copilot Preview from Windows"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_vzakTnWozp-1024x265.webp 1024w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_vzakTnWozp-300x78.webp 300w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_vzakTnWozp-768x199.webp 768w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_vzakTnWozp-1536x398.webp 1536w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/ApplicationFrameHost_vzakTnWozp.webp 1791w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px" /><figcaption class="wp-element-caption">Remove Copilot Preview from Windows</figcaption></figure>



<p>That&#8217;s it. In this way, you can remove the copilot preview from your taskbar without permanently disabling it. </p>

<h2>Enable MS Copilot in Windows 11 &#8211; Quick Steps:</h2>
<p>The easiest way to enable this AI Assistant in Windows 11 is via Task Bar Settings.</p>
<ul>
<li>Right-click on the Taskbar and click on <strong>Taskbar Settings</strong>.
<p><figure id="attachment_276"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-276" style="width: 928px" class="wp-caption alignnone"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="wp-image-276 size-full"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Task-Bar-Settings.jpg" alt="Task Bar Settings" width="928" height="424" title="How to Enable Microsoft Copilot in Windows 11? 2"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Task-Bar-Settings.jpg 928w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Task-Bar-Settings-300x137.jpg 300w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Task-Bar-Settings-768x351.jpg 768w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 928px) 100vw, 928px" /><figcaption id="caption-attachment-276" class="wp-caption-text">Task Bar Settings</figcaption></figure></li>
<li>Under <strong>Taskbar items</strong> of <strong>Personalization &gt; Taskbar</strong>, you can find Copilot. As of this article&#8217;s date, the preview version of Copilot is available.
<p><figure id="attachment_277"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-277" style="width: 1326px" class="wp-caption alignnone"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="wp-image-277 size-full"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Turn-on-Copilot.jpg" alt="Turn on Copilot" width="1326" height="507" title="How to Enable Microsoft Copilot in Windows 11? 3"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Turn-on-Copilot.jpg 1326w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Turn-on-Copilot-300x115.jpg 300w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Turn-on-Copilot-1024x392.jpg 1024w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/04/Turn-on-Copilot-768x294.jpg 768w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 1326px) 100vw, 1326px" /><figcaption id="caption-attachment-277" class="wp-caption-text">Turn on Copilot</figcaption></figure></li>
<li>Toggle the switch to <strong>turn on Microsoft Copilot in Windows 11</strong>.</li>
<li>That is it, you can now find Copilot pinned to the Taskbar.</li>
</ul>

<h2>Disable Copilot in Edge Browser in Windows 11 &#8211; Simple Steps:</h2>
<ul>
<li>Open the Edge browser on your Windows 11 computer.</li>
<li>Click on the <strong>menu icon (three horizontal dots)</strong> in the top-right corner of the browser window.
<p><figure id="attachment_244"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-244" style="width: 1919px" class="wp-caption alignnone"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="wp-image-244 size-full"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Menu.jpg" alt="Menu" width="1919" height="474" title="How to Disable Microsoft Copilot in Edge Browser? - Windows 11 5"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Menu.jpg 1919w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Menu-300x74.jpg 300w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Menu-1024x253.jpg 1024w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Menu-768x190.jpg 768w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Menu-1536x379.jpg 1536w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 1919px) 100vw, 1919px" /><figcaption id="caption-attachment-244" class="wp-caption-text">Menu</figcaption></figure></li>
<li>Select &#8220;<strong>Settings</strong>&#8221; from the menu.
<p><figure id="attachment_245"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-245" style="width: 1919px" class="wp-caption alignnone"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="wp-image-245 size-full"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Settings.jpg" alt="Settings" width="1919" height="848" title="How to Disable Microsoft Copilot in Edge Browser? - Windows 11 6"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Settings.jpg 1919w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Settings-300x133.jpg 300w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Settings-1024x453.jpg 1024w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Settings-768x339.jpg 768w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Settings-1536x679.jpg 1536w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 1919px) 100vw, 1919px" /><figcaption id="caption-attachment-245" class="wp-caption-text">Settings</figcaption></figure></li>
<li>In the Settings menu, scroll down and click on &#8220;<strong>Sidebar</strong>&#8221; in the left sidebar.
<p><figure id="attachment_246"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-246" style="width: 1919px" class="wp-caption alignnone"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="wp-image-246 size-full"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/sidebar.jpg" alt="Sidebar" width="1919" height="1014" title="How to Disable Microsoft Copilot in Edge Browser? - Windows 11 7"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/sidebar.jpg 1919w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/sidebar-300x159.jpg 300w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/sidebar-1024x541.jpg 1024w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/sidebar-768x406.jpg 768w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/sidebar-1536x812.jpg 1536w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 1919px) 100vw, 1919px" /><figcaption id="caption-attachment-246" class="wp-caption-text">Sidebar</figcaption></figure></li>
<li>Under App and Notification settings, you can find Copilot. Click on that.
<p><figure id="attachment_247"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-247" style="width: 1919px" class="wp-caption alignnone"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="wp-image-247 size-full"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/copilot.jpg" alt="Apps and Notification Settings - Copilot" width="1919" height="938" title="How to Disable Microsoft Copilot in Edge Browser? - Windows 11 8"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/copilot.jpg 1919w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/copilot-300x147.jpg 300w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/copilot-1024x501.jpg 1024w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/copilot-768x375.jpg 768w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/copilot-1536x751.jpg 1536w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 1919px) 100vw, 1919px" /><figcaption id="caption-attachment-247" class="wp-caption-text">Apps and Notification Settings &#8211; Copilot</figcaption></figure></li>
<li>Toggle the Show Copilot Switch to OFF. Also, turn off the Show shopping notification.
<p><figure id="attachment_248"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-248" style="width: 1919px" class="wp-caption alignnone"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="wp-image-248 size-full"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/showcopilot.jpg" alt="Show Copilot" width="1919" height="555" title="How to Disable Microsoft Copilot in Edge Browser? - Windows 11 9"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/showcopilot.jpg 1919w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/showcopilot-300x87.jpg 300w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/showcopilot-1024x296.jpg 1024w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/showcopilot-768x222.jpg 768w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/showcopilot-1536x444.jpg 1536w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 1919px) 100vw, 1919px" /><figcaption id="caption-attachment-248" class="wp-caption-text">Show Copilot</figcaption></figure></li>
<li>Microsoft Edge will prompt for a restart. Restart the Browser.
<p><figure id="attachment_249" aria-describedby="caption-attachment-249" style="width: 1919px" class="wp-caption alignnone"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="wp-image-249 size-full" src="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Restart.jpg" alt="Restart Edge Browser" width="1919" height="604" title="How to Disable Microsoft Copilot in Edge Browser? - Windows 11 10" srcset="https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Restart.jpg 1919w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Restart-300x94.jpg 300w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Restart-1024x322.jpg 1024w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Restart-768x242.jpg 768w, https://winsides.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/03/Restart-1536x483.jpg 1536w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 1919px) 100vw, 1919px" /><figcaption id="caption-attachment-249" class="wp-caption-text">Restart Edge Browser</figcaption></figure></li>
<li>That is it. <strong>Microsoft Copilot is now disabled in the Microsoft Edge Browser in Windows 11</strong>.</li>
</ul>
